Yven Bergwijn on Joining Al-Ittihad: A New Challenge in the Saudi League
Dutch footballer Yven Bergwijn, who recently made the move from Ajax to Al-Ittihad, has shared his thoughts on the transfer negotiations and the experience of joining his new team.
In an interview with ESPN, Bergwijn expressed his happiness about the move, despite initial reservations about leaving Ajax. ”I didn’t have to leave the Dutch team, but you have to think about yourself,” he said. “It was a great step, and I’m happy to be playing in the Saudi league.”
Bergwijn views his move to Al-Ittihad as a significant challenge, citing the presence of many talented players in the Saudi League. “Going to Al-Ittihad Club is a great challenge,” he said. “We see a lot of good players going to the Saudi League, and it will be a great adventure after taking part in big football events.”
Regarding the transfer process, Bergwijn recalled receiving a message about the need for a medical examination, which ultimately led to the completion of the deal. “I received a message in the morning that it was tiring for Ajax to provide an option to go to the hospital for a medical examination, but things were finally done,” he said.
